09 s60 2.5t
replaced both low beam bulbs. They worked fine for 2-3weeks. Now I’m getting a bulb failure but only with the turn signal on. The bulb dims and starts flashing with the turn signal. What’s my first step to getting this fixed? Thanks in advance.

are the headlights still working ok? its really not that uncommon for both headlights to go out relatively close to one another, particularly if you leave them on as running lights. As to the turn signals, did you replace those bulbs yet? I'd start by replacing the bulbs and while you have them out check the sockets for any signs of corrosion/looseness. Then check voltage at the socket and on the ground. could be a bad bulb, a socket issue or a bad ground. Last it could be the flasher relay or the multi-function stalk.
